Cooroy Is More Popular Than Ever

Cooroy is more popular than ever, and for good reason. From very humble beginnings Cooroy is expanding and modernising with trendy cafes, restaurants, parks and has a strong community atmosphere, just say g'day to a local in the street and you will see what I mean. People moving to this part of the coast are seeing Cooroy as a quieter option with a 'country town' feel, but still a very short drive to the tourism mecca of Noosa Heads.

What makes this property the perfect option, is that it's a younger home, just three years old and has all the elements that would suit a young family, or a couple looking to get into the Cooroy property market. Just walking around this estate, it is super quiet, and you have access to a network of pathways and parks, all within a short walk from your front door. Being in an elevated cul-de-sac, you only see locals in the street, or the odd game of cricket amongst neighbouring kids.

The floor plan of the home is smart, both maximising the living spaces and positioning the home on the block to increase backyard space and room for entertaining around the pool. The position of the home also leaves space for a side gate access if you need to put a boat or caravan outdoors.

The main living area is open plan combining the kitchen, dining and lounge space, which has direct sliding door access to the alfresco entertaining area. A second lounge was incorporated into the floor plan as a media room or second sitting room/lounge, which has a lovely backyard view. The living area feels like the heart of the home where you can prepare meals in the well-equipped kitchen featuring a large oven, electric cook tops, dishwasher and a walk-in pantry. Plus, for the multi-tasking mums and dads, you will be pleased to keep an eye on the kids in the pool from the living area.

The pool was a later addition to the home and is positioned nicely for full sunlight throughout the day and with enough space to build a poolside cabana if the new owner wishes. Outside the pool enclosure there is loads of space for kids (or the dog) to roam all within a safe fully fenced yard.

The bedrooms in the home are spread across the floor plan, with the master suite very central and features a walk-in robe and a beautifully presented ensuite bathroom. The three children's bedrooms are all typical doubles with their own unique aspects, built-in robes, and ceiling fans. The materials and colour schemes chosen for the build are all very neutral, so as the new owner you can easily put your own touch on this modern Cooroy residence.
